1. Formal Translation I, Paul, am appealing to you through the meekness and gentleness of Christ {Christos, Perfect Gentle Model}—I who, face to face, am lowly among you, yet when absent I speak boldly toward you. |
1. Dynamic Translation I, Paul, urge you by the humility and kindness of Christ {Christos, Patient Serving Lord}. When I am with you I come gently, but when I am away I speak with confidence toward you. |
